Air conditioning has become a standard feature in modern vehicles – whether cars, trucks, agricultural or special-purpose vehicles. By reducing the temperature, it increases comfort during journeys and makes traffic jams in crowded cities more bearable. Like any component, air conditioning systems require maintenance. Two of the most common tasks include refilling the refrigerant and repairing system leaks, which are often caused by damaged or outdated O-rings.

Rubber O-rings – a basic type of seal – are manufactured from various elastomer compounds. Each rubber compound is tailored for specific applications, meaning that the choice of O-ring material must match the refrigerant used in the system. Which A/C O-Rings to Choose?

A customer recently contacted us about air conditioning O-rings for his car. Our first question was: which refrigerant is in the vehicle’s system? As the customer didn’t know, we checked the make, model and year of production – and quickly identified it used the R-134a refrigerant. This is a widely used refrigerant with a Global Warming Potential (GWP) of 1430.

Thanks to our extensive experience, we knew that EPDM O-rings are ideal for R-134a-based A/C systems. It’s worth noting that the EU Directive 2006/40/EC recommends using refrigerants with a GWP below 150. HFO-1234yf, developed by Honeywell and DuPont, meets this requirement but poses skin burn risks. Some car manufacturers, like Mercedes-Benz, have moved away from it due to lower safety ratings in crash tests.

Green O-Rings – A/C Seal Rings

One customer was unsure about the colour of the required O-rings. In Poland, green is the conventional colour for EPDM O-rings used with R-134a. To explain this, we use a local example: imagine most BMWs in the town of Pruszków are black – but if someone wants a green one, the manufacturer can deliver. It’s the same with O-rings: colour is optional. We’ve supplied red and even silver-grey EPDM O-rings – colour depends on visibility and use case.

Automotive A/C O-Rings – Why Green?

Green EPDM O-rings are highly visible in engine compartments, which are typically black or metallic. This visibility aids technicians during servicing. Important Note: Colour ≠ Material

The colour of a rubber O-ring doesn’t determine the compound used or its chemical resistance. Choosing based on colour alone can be risky.
